The Government have issued a flood alert to Burnham residents.

The alert was issued to the Essex coast from St Peters Flat to and including Shoeburyness and the Crouch and Roach estuaries.

There is a possibility of some minor flooding to coastal roads and footpaths between 12:30pm and 02:30pm on Monday 30th September 2019.

Tides are expected to be higher than usual due to high spring tides and a small surge.

The Government have urged people to take care on coastal roads and footpaths and not to put yourself in unnecessary danger.

They will continue to monitor the situation and will reissue this message for any subsequent tides if required.
